ScopingWithin the similar scope, all the declared identifiers should be unique. So, even if their datatypes differ, the variables and parameters cannot share the similar name. For illustration, two of the declarations below are illegal:DECLAREvalid_id BOOLEAN;valid_id VARCHAR2(5); -- illegal duplicate identifierFUNCTION bonus (valid_id IN INTEGER) RETURN REAL IS... -- illegal triplicate identifier
